Low Carb Barbecue Meatballs

These low carb BBQ meatballs are a flavorful, easy dinner made with simple ingredients and a sugar free barbecue sauce.
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time20 minutes
Total Time30 minutes

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
  • In a bowl, add the barbecue seasoning, pepper and salt to the ground beef and mix together.
  • Add the egg, minced garlic and the parmesan cheese on top of the seasoned ground beef.  Use your hands to knead together all the ingredients until well combined.
  • Roll out 1 inch sized balls of the ground beef and place on a foiled baking sheet. (you can also use parchment paper)
  • In a separate small bowl, mix the Italian dressing and sugar free barbecue sauce together until smooth.
  • Place a small spoonful of the barbecue mix on top of each meatball before placing in the oven.
  • Cook in the oven for 10 minutes, then place another large spoonful of barbecue sauce over each meatball.
  • Place meatballs back in the oven and cook for another 10 minutes, increasing the oven temperature to 375 degrees F.
  • Remove from the oven and serve in any leftover Italian barbecue sauce or stick with toothpicks to serve as an appetizer!

Notes

Serve immediately.
To store: Place in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 5 days. 
To reheat: Place back on a baking sheet in the oven at 300 degrees for 10 minutes or place in a microwavable bowl for 1- 2 minutes.
